Ganderbal sports festival concludes | KNO

Srinagar, January 09 (KNO) : Closing ceremony of Ganderbal Sports Festival which was organized by Jammu and Kashmir Police under civic action programme, was held in Ganderbal. The sports festival was inaugurated by DIG CKR Shri Ghulam Hassan Bhat on 30th of October 2017 at Sainik School Manasbal. The closing ceremony was witnessed by the DIG CKR Shri Ghulam Hassan Bhat who was the chief guest on the occasion. Among others SSP Ganderbal Shri Fayaz Ahmad Lone, other Police officers and respectable persons of District Ganderbal were present on the occassion. While speaking on the occasion, Shri Ghulam Hassan Bhat said that these spots festivals are organized to explore the talent of youth of the state. Jammu and Kashmir Police is trying to boost the morale of talented youths and to channelize the talent to the international level, he said. Two matches of Tug of War and Kabbadi were played on the closing ceremony. Tug of War was played between Navodian Tigers and Degree College Ganderbal while the Kabbadi match was played between Kabbadi Academy Ganderbal and Navodian Tigers. Games including volleyball, Football, Badminton, Martial Arts and Cricket were also played during the sports festival. Deputy Inspector General of Police Shri Ghulam Hassan Bhat distributed the trophies as well as cash rewards and certificates among the participants.(KNO)
